Russia's offensive in eastern Ukraine is making slow and steady progress. Russian troops are getting closer to fully taking over a key strategic city that might enable it to completely control the Donbas region which is the industrial heartland of the country. Hope isn't lost for Ukraine but is Russia bolstered by the decreasing focus on Ukraine by the West? Aaron David Miller is a Senior Fellow at the Carnegie Endowment for International Peace and a CNN Global Affairs Analyst.
